RCSQUARED ENTERPRISES, LLC

Behavioral Health

RCSQUARED ENTERPRISES, LLC is a Behavioral Health in SAINT PETERS, MO, US.

150 SAINT PETERS CENTRE BLVD STE B, SAINT PETERS, MO, US
6158307546